Scope of Work and Objectives
The objective of this tender is to procure various components crucial for the maintenance and operation of a Two Ton Forklift Truck (FLT). The comprehensive scope includes the supply of packing kits with gaskets, piston rings, star couplings, water hose pipes, and other essential maintenance parts. The total quantity required for this tender is 102 units distributed across multiple components aimed at ensuring the operational efficiency of the FLT two ton vehicles.
